Ataky
Ataky is a commune in Dnistrovskyi Raion, Chernivtsi Oblast, Ukraine. It belongs to Khotyn urban hromada, one of the hromadas of Ukraine. Until 18 July 2020, Ataky belonged to Khotyn Raion.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Zhvanets
Village

Zhvanets is a village in Kamianets-Podilskyi Raion of Khmelnytskyi Oblast in western Ukraine. It hosts the administration of Zhvanets rural hromada, one of the hromadas of Ukraine. The village's population was 1,529 as of the 2001 Ukrainian census.
Okopy
Village

Okopy is a selo in western Ukraine. It is located in Chortkiv Raion of Ternopil Oblast, and had its origins as a Polish fortress at the meeting of the Zbruch and Dniester rivers. Okopy is situated 4 km west of Ataky.
